15 EXTENSION MISTAKES TO AVOID
Homebuilding & Renovating
|May 2025
Planning on extending? Follow our 15 invaluable tips to ensure your build progresses without delays, extra costs, or other major hitches
So you're considering extending rather than moving? When planning your extension, it's worth bearing in mind that while it can be easy to get carried away envisaging the end results, the path to completion is rarely one that's without the odd bump along the way. We can't claim to guarantee you an entirely smooth build, but we can offer expert advice on some of the pitfalls to avoid. After all, building an extension is a big deal and doesn't come without costs and an element of upheaval. Here's what the experts say are some of the most common extension mistakes and how you can avoid falling foul of them.
1 EXTENDING WHEN YOU DON'T NEED TO
Although it can be easy to assume an extension is your only option for increasing usable space in your home, it can help to take a step back first, says Steven George, partner and design lead at architectural practice, George & Co.
“One common mistake clients make is thinking an extension is the only solution to the lack of space,” says Steven. “Instead, it usually helps in the first instance to look at the house as a whole. While it's not always the case, often we can find wasted space and look to make the current floorplan work harder than it currently does. After all, extending a property is expensive as extension costs mount up and the end result might not always deal with the problems inside your home—it just allows you to forget about them.”
2 NOT CALLING ON THE PROFESSIONALS EARLY ENOUGH
When looking for inspiration for your house extension, don't assume that you need to have everything decided before you engage with professionals. Instead, allow their expertise to guide the decision-making process. After all, while your vision matters, knowing how to practically make it happen takes years of training and skills that you may not always have.
